Fit & Comfort
You want your nurse costume to fit just right. A good fit helps you move easily and keeps you feeling confident. Latex hugs your body, so you should check the size chart before you buy. If you are between sizes, go for the bigger one. Latex does not stretch as much as other fabrics.
Tip: Try seamless undergarments. They help you get a smooth look under your latex nurse outfit. No one wants to see lines or bumps!
If you need a plus-size nurse costume, many shops now offer more sizes. Some even make custom outfits just for you. Custom-made pieces can fit your body shape better and feel more comfortable. Think about the event, too. If you plan to dance at a halloween party, you might want a looser fit. For a photoshoot or cosplay, a tighter fit looks great in pictures.

Quality & Shine
A high-quality nurse costume will last longer and look better. Look for thick latex that feels strong but still lets you move. Cheap latex can tear or lose its shine fast. You want your latex nurse outfit to stand out, especially at a big halloween event.
Shine is a big part of the look. Latex looks best when it is glossy and smooth. Use a latex shiner or silicone spray to get that perfect shine. Some costumes come pre-shined, but you can always add more before you go out.
Note: Always check the seams and zippers. Good stitching means your nurse costume will not fall apart during a busy night.

Moving in Latex
Latex feels different from regular clothes. It fits close to your skin and can feel tight. You need to practice moving in your nurse costume before the big event. Try walking, sitting, and even dancing at home. This helps you get used to the feeling. If you plan to wear your latex nurse outfit for hours, take short breaks to stretch.
Tip: Use a little talc or silicone spray inside your nurse costume. This makes it easier to put on and take off.
Wardrobe Tips
You want your nurse costume to stay in place all night. Check all zippers and seams before you leave home. Bring a small repair kit with you. A travel-size bottle of latex shiner, a few safety pins, and some double-sided tape can save the day. If you worry about sweat, wear a thin, seamless base layer under your nurse costume. This keeps you comfortable and helps protect the latex.

FAQ
How do you keep a latex nurse outfit shiny all night?
Use a latex shiner or silicone spray before you leave. Carry a small bottle for touch-ups. Avoid touching rough surfaces. Shine fades if you sweat a lot, so reapply as needed.
Can you wear a latex nurse outfit if you have sensitive skin?
Yes, you can. Wear a thin, seamless base layer under your outfit. This helps protect your skin. Test a small patch of latex first to check for any reaction.
What is the best way to store a latex nurse costume?
Hang your costume on a padded hanger in a cool, dark place. Keep it away from sunlight and metal. You can also dust it with talc to prevent sticking.
How do you fix small tears in latex?
Use latex glue for small rips. Clean the area first. Apply a thin layer of glue and press the edges together. Let it dry completely before wearing again.
